Author: julianfoad
Date: Thu Nov 30 21:18:02 2017
New Revision: 1816762
URL: http://svn.apache.org/viewvc?rev=1816762&view=rev
Log:
Resolve two "loses integer precision" warnings.
Found by: danielsh
Modified:
subversion/trunk/subversion/libsvn_client/shelve.c
subversion/trunk/subversion/svn/shelve-cmd.c
Modified: subversion/trunk/subversion/libsvn_client/shelve.c
URL:
http://svn.apache.org/viewvc/subversion/trunk/subversion/libsvn_client/shelve.c?rev=1816762&r1=1816761&r2=1816762&view=diff
==============================================================================
--- subversion/trunk/subversion/libsvn_client/shelve.c (original)
+++ subversion/trunk/subversion/libsvn_client/shelve.c Thu Nov 30 21:18:02 2017
@@ -386,7 +386,7 @@ svn_client_shelves_list(apr_hash_t **she
for (hi = apr_hash_first(scratch_pool, dirents); hi; hi = apr_hash_next(hi))
{
const char *filename = apr_hash_this_key(hi);
- int len = strlen(filename);
+ size_t len = strlen(filename);
if (len > 6 && strcmp(filename + len - 6, ".patch") == 0)
{
Modified: subversion/trunk/subversion/svn/shelve-cmd.c
URL:
http://svn.apache.org/viewvc/subversion/trunk/subversion/svn/shelve-cmd.c?rev=1816762&r1=1816761&r2=1816762&view=diff
==============================================================================
--- subversion/trunk/subversion/svn/shelve-cmd.c (original)
+++ subversion/trunk/subversion/svn/shelve-cmd.c Thu Nov 30 21:18:02 2017
@@ -102,7 +102,7 @@ shelves_list(const char *local_abspath,
const svn_sort__item_t *item = &APR_ARRAY_IDX(list, i, svn_sort__item_t);
const char *name = item->key;
svn_client_shelved_patch_info_t *info = item->value;
- int age = (apr_time_now() - info->mtime) / 1000000 / 60;
+ int age = (int)((apr_time_now() - info->mtime) / 1000000 / 60);
SVN_ERR(svn_cmdline_printf(scratch_pool,
_("%-30s %6d mins old %10ld bytes\n"),